Boyko pitches 46-save shutout as Oilers top Mavericks 5-0 on Teddy Bear Toss Night in Missouri.  

Independence, Mo. —The Tulsa Oilers, proud ECHL affiliate of the NHL’s Anaheim Ducks and the AHL’s San Diego Gulls and powered by Community Care, shutout the Kansas City Mavericks 5-0 on Saturday night at Cable Dahmer Arena in Independence, Missouri.

Tyler Poulsen scored his seventh of the season, beating Viktor Ostman against the grain 6:19 into the game to send the Oilers up 1-0 into the first intermission. The goal was Poulsen’s first since coming back last night from an injured-reserve hiatus dating back to Nov. 24.

 

Olivier Dame-Malka put the Oilers up 2-0 with his first as an Oiler, driving a power-play one timer from the right point 5:39 into the action. Jeremie Biakabutuka earned his first assist as an Oiler on the goal, flipping roles with Dame-Malka, who set up Biakabutuka on the power-play in Friday’s game. Reid Petryk recorded the secondary assist on both goals.

 

Michael Farren finished a beneath-the-line feed from Josh Nelson, putting Tulsa up 3-0 9:07 into the final frame. The goal extends Farren’s point streak to six games. Farren added his second of the frame with an empty-net finish set up by Conner Roulette. Nelson added a goal of his own, beating Ostman with a high-glove snapshot with 13 seconds remaining to seal the 5-0 shutout victory.

 

Talyn Boyko made 46 saves, stopping 15 shots in the first period, 12 in the second and 19 in the third. The Oilers power play went 1/1 and Tulsa went 6/6 on the penalty kill. 

 

 The Oilers return home tomorrow, Dec. 22 to host the Allen Americans at 3:05 p.m. in the final home game of the 2024 calendar year.
